2013-07-25 50 views
-4

我想創建一個「靜靜地」查詢其他頁面的頁面。然後它抓取它們以獲得結果。查詢完所有頁面後,應根據檢索結果計算自己的結果。如何在不同的上下文中加載多個網站?

我的意思是什麼無聲的,

  1. 其他Web站點的代碼將不會出現在我的網頁上,也不會影響以任何方式
  2. 我想在不同的會議要查詢對方頁(就像我在瀏覽器中爲每個標籤打開一個新標籤)或類似的東西。這樣就不會有命名空間問題。

我聽說鉻會提供一些可能對此有幫助的事情嗎?

編輯這不是關於抓取網頁。這是從其他地方單機獲取數據項目

EDIT2我只是尋找一種替代簡單循環URL和querieng他們,因爲有名稱空間問題

回答

2

您不能訪問頁面從除非域明確允許你的域,否則使用JavaScript的其他域。

通常,您會使用服務器端語言進行此操作,或更好地使用網站的公共API。如果他們沒有公共API,他們可能不會感激您爬行他們的網站。

+0

<<如果他們沒有公共的API,他們可能不會感激您爬行他們的網站>>所有的說法! –

+0

我知道......同源政策。但是因爲我用於本地網絡,所以不存在這樣的問題。並沒有API。有一些服裝測試頁面,我需要從他們那裏獲取數據。 – keinabel